No question that TCU will be the second best team NIU faces this year...i was impressed with the win over AFA.

What I noticed was that TCU blitzes a ton and runs lots of stunts. With that they still applied lots of pressure even with a 4 man rush...D-line apears quick...

What I did notice was that their were WR's open and a good mobile QB can makes some plays...given the quickenss od the D it seems to me misdirection might catch them overpursuing a bit..

As fars as offesnively....TCU score a ton....but the offense never appeared overpowering...could just be the competition...but I do like our D against your O

This will be a very good match-up...and I do beleive it will be close...NIU will have to use the pass to set up the run....NIU will have to spread the filed early in order to openb things up

If NIU D shows up and Nicholson is as good as we hope...NIU could pull this one out...no

Patterson likes to recruit speed on both sides of the ball. Our best DE Tommy Blake was a running back in high school as really has great speed for a DE. TCU also likes to blitz with a lot of different looks like you said. Jason Phillips as LB was a duel threat QB in high school who came into TCU running a 4.5 40 as a HS senior. He has probably slowed down a little as he bulked up to play LB, but he is still very quick.

Do any of yall have any online video of Nicholson, the only time I have seen him play was in last years MACC. What has he been like in action this season? Who are your receiving threats?
